At JMU: Fourth-year Duke who should be among the team’s top WR… a hard-working and clutch player with outstanding body control and desire to win, said WR coach Tony Tallent.
2003: Played in each JMU game and started three of its last four… second on the team in receptions and receiving yards and tied for second in TD catches… had a reception in each game except for Virginia Tech… had a career-high six catches (83 yards) vs. Liberty… had five receptions (91 yards) and a TD (21 yards) at Massachusetts… had four catches for 41 yards at Villanova… had three catches for 52 yards and a TD (eight yards) vs. Richmond… had three catches for 43 yards and a TD (19) yards vs. Charleston Southern… had a season-long 29-yard reception vs. Richmond and catches of 26 yards at Massachusetts and 20 yards vs. Liberty.
2002: Played in each JMU game… third on the team in catches and receiving yards… had 10 catches for 139 yards in JMU’s last four games, including five for 77 yards at Rhode Island… had two catches for 34 yards vs. William & Mary, two for 17 yards vs. Hampton, and two for 16 yards vs. Massachusetts… caught passes vs. Hofstra, Maine, and Northeastern… had a season-long 25-yard catch to help set up JMU’s first TD vs. William & Mary.
High School: Four-year football performer and second-team all-district as a Kempsville senior… district winner in the 110- and 300-meter hurdles… MVP in track as a senior and had the top grade-point average on the track and football teams. Personal: Nicolas Jeb Tolley… born Aug. 23, 1983… business management major… father was a gymnast at Old Dominion… A-10 academic honoree.
